Description
For courses in Human Biology taken primarily by non-science majors but which might also include students in applied medical or nursing specializations.
This lively narrative personalizes the study of human biology with a friendly writing style, stunning art, abundant applications, and tools to help students develop critical-thinking skills. With clarity, currency, and consistency, the authors give students a conceptual framework for understanding how their bodies work and for dealing with issues relevant to human health in the modern world. Students will gain an appreciation for the intricacy of human biology and the place of humans in the ecosphere.
